## Runbook: vendoring third-party fonts for Typeharbor

For this week's sync: we now vendor all third-party fonts into the Typeharbor repository rather than fetching them at build time. This removes an external dependency and makes license audits reproducible. The vendoring job verifies checksums against a pinned manifest before committing. It reads the following configuration at startup.

config for kagup-hahig:
druwyn:
  pin: 2801
  metrics_host: metrics.druwyn.zemvarlabs.internal
  tenant: sorius
  seal: seal_798a43d7

**14:22** — Localization rollout paused. The Fennwick billing page rendered dd/mm dates for the Meridale locale while invoices still emitted mm/dd, creating a genuine ambiguity for dates before the 13th. We confirmed the regression came from the locale-table refresh, not the formatter itself, and reverted the table while keeping the formatter live. No customer invoices were regenerated. The reverted artifact corresponds to the build identifier recorded below.

session token of tajef-bageg = htk21_5d90d574934f3ccae6437

Subject: Lease Renegotiation — Hartwell Plaza

Team,

Quick update for the sales leads: Quindell Foods has reopened lease talks for the Hartwell Plaza office. We expect a 12% reduction in rent in exchange for a five-year extension. Client meeting space is unaffected through the transition. Please keep prospect visits scheduled as normal. The reason we are locking in this site relates to the confidential plan below.

management briefing: Kelielek Group plans to lower the Holir list price by 61 percent in January.